Greenfield Township is one of seventeen townships in Adair County, Iowa, USA. At the 2010 census, its population was 2,072. [3]
Greenfield Township was first settled in 1854. [4] This township was organized in 1859. [5]
Greenfield Township covers an area of 5.71 square miles (14.8 km2). According to the USGS, it contains one cemetery, Greenfield.
